2012/2013 SCREENING EXERCISE FOR UNN POST UME HAS BEEN FIXED

The University of Nigeria, Nsukka hereby invites candidates who made her either their first or second
choice in the 2012 Universities Tertiary Matriculation Examination (UTME) and scored 200 or above for
screening.
The screening will be conducted at the Nsukka campus of the University as follows:
DAY ONE
DATE: Monday, June 18, 2012
DAY TWO
DATE: Tuesday, June 19, 2012
DAY THREE
DATE: Wednesday, June 20, 2012
DAY ONE:    FACULTIES: FACULTIES: FACULTIES:
Faculty of Dentistry
Faculty of Health Sciences &
Technology
Faculty of Medical Sciences
Faculty of Pharmaceutical Sciences
Faculty of Veterinary Medicine
DAY TWO
Faculty of Arts
Faculty of Education
Faculty of Law
Faculty of the Social Sciences
(including all candidates who
applied for Public Admin. &
Local Govt.)
DAY THREE
Faculty of Agriculture
Faculty of Biological Sciences
Faculty of Business Administration
Faculty of Engineering
Faculty of Environmental Studies
(including all candidates who
applied for Surveying &
Geoinformatics)
Faculty of Physical Sciences
ONLINE PRE-REGISTRATION
a) Eligible candidates should pay a processing fee of Two thousand Naira (N2,000) and obtain a
scratch card for online pre-registration at any branch of
 First Bank of Nigeria Plc,
 Diamond Bank Plc, in the major cities of the Federation, and the
 University of Nigeria Micro-Finance Banks at Enugu and Nsukka.
b) Online Pre-registration commences on Friday, June 01, 2012 and ends on Tuesday, June 12,
2012. Those who fail to register within this period will not be screened.
With the scratch card, candidates should access and complete the University of Nigeria 2012/2013
Post-UTME screening form online at www.portal.unn.edu.ng.
Note: Candidates must not scan any passport photograph on their forms.
c) All candidates are required to bring the following for the screening exercise:
i. A copy of ONLINE form duly completed;
ii. 2012/2013 JAMB slip;
iii. HB Pencil and Eraser.
No GSM handsets, calculators or any other extraneous materials should be brought into the screening
halls.
Information on the Venues for the screening will be made available at the campus and on the University of
Nigeria website, a day to the screening dates.
VISUALLY IMPAIRED CANDIDATES
Blind candidates who scored 180 and above should register online, but they are not invited to the screening
exercise.
Candidates may also visit the University of Nigeria website, www.unn.edu.ng, for this information.
The details of the Screening Exercise for Direct Entry candidates would be announced later.
